Visit to Richtersveld and Ai Ais Transfronteer Park
"The staff at Sendelings drift were fantastic, we underestimated the traveling time and were late arriving on Saturday evening, we planned to camp at Sendelings Drift but because we arrived late and had children with us we requested two Chalets for the night. Our request was no problem and the duty manager (Carmen) came from her home to let us have the keys. The friendly way in which we were treated was really wonderful particularly after a long trip. Thank you to Elias at the gate, he was very eager to help with advice.
We camped at de Hoop for four nights and really enjoyed the experience.
The only negative of the trip was, after we had crossed into Namibia and passed through the Border Post, to be harassed by two members of the Namibian Police scratching through wallets and bags apparently looking for diamonds but all the while trying to solicit bribes in money or in kind. Other than this one incident we really enjoyed our stay!"

De Hoop Restcamp
"The campsite was lovely. We were expecting rustic which is what we got. The roads are in shocking condition and the goats and sheep that are allowed to graze in the park was a disappointing sight."

De Hoop Restcamp
"Thank you for the Richtersveld, it was awesome!
Some of the roads are just badly corrugated, and something sad was the new diggings between De Hoop, and Die Werf. It is sad to see how badly dug up this part is, and that it is simply left this way.
But once again, thank you for the opportunity to visit this amazing sacred place."
